About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Direct the pre-launch, launch, and lifecycle medical strategy for oncology pipeline.
  • Bridge different cross functional teams for successful therapeutic adoption.
  • Oversee medical education, data generation, and external collaborations to maximize patient impact.
  • Co-develop and execute a comprehensive, long-term pre- and peri launch medical plan.
  • Translate medical strategy into actionable regional/local launch tactics.
  • Lead operationalization of the Medical Launch Readiness Framework.
  • Map, establish, and maintain trusted relationships with Tier-1 Oncology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s).

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Advanced degree required: PharmD, MD, PhD, or equivalent in a relevant life sciences discipline.
  • 12+ years of experience in Medical Affairs, with at least 5+ years supporting oncology product launches and lifecycle management
  • Deep therapeutic knowledge and proven ability to influence without authority, manage budgets and lead cross functional matrix teams
  • Exceptional verbal and written scientific communication skills with ability to distill complex clinical data into digestible strategies.
  • Experience at a biotech company navigating first or second product launch.
  • Exposure to HEOR, RWE, or registry evidence generation in a field setting.
